Nevada: In Primm, hear Kenny Rogers, the Jacksons, others from $11
Kenny Rogers and the Jacksons are among the headliners whose concerts in Primm, Nev. – at the California-Nevada state line about 225 miles from L.A. – you can enjoy for as little as $11 a person, excluding taxes and fees.
“From country to R&B;, norteno music and more, our schedule of concerts includes something for fans of all genres,” Loren Gill, general manager of Primm Valley Casino Resorts, said in a news release.
The concerts will be in the 6,500-seat Star of the Desert Arena. The bargain-priced lineup begins Saturday with a performance by San Jose-based Los Tigres del Norte, a band with its roots in Mexican norteno music.
The concert calendar for the rest of the year also includes:
Aug. 31: Country music legend Kenny Rogers
Sept. 14: The Jacksons, a group composed of Michael Jackson’s brothers
Oct. 5: Country music band Lonestar
Oct. 26: Mexican singer-songwriter Ramon Ayala
Nov. 2: Country quartet the Oak Ridge Boys
Dec. 28: The O’Jays, an R&B; group formed in 1958
The location of the budget seats will vary, depending on the sale of higher-priced tickets. They’re available through Ticketmaster or by calling (800) 745-3000.
With fees included, the lowest-priced tickets sell for $18.70. For Kenny Rogers, the highest-priced tickets cost $47.20, fees included. Patrons can save about $5 per ticket at the resort box office.
Primm is about 40 miles south of the Las Vegas Strip along Interstate 15.
